Document: We propose a linear model of opinion dynamics that builds on, and extends, the celebrated DeGroot model. Its primary innovation is that it concerns relative opinions, in that two opinion vectors that differ only by a multiplicative constant are considered equivalent. An agent's opinion is represented by a number in R, and evolves due to positive and negative impacts resulting from the other agents' opinions. As a consequence of the relative interpretation, the model exhibits nonlinear dynamics despite its DeGroot-like linear foundation. This means that, even when agents are"well-connected", the dynamics of the relative opinion model can reproduce phenomena such as polarization, consensus formation, and periodic behavior. An important additional advantage of remaining in a DeGroot-type framework is that it allows for extensive analytical investigation using elementary matrix algebra. A few specific themes are covered: (i) We demonstrate how stable patterns in opinion dynamics are identified which are hidden when only absolute opinions are considered, such as stable fragmentation of a population despite a continuous shift in absolute opinions. (ii) For the two-agent case, we provide an exhaustive description of the model's asymptotic (long-term, that is) behavior. (iii) We explore group dynamics, in particular providing a non-trivial condition under which a group's asymptotic behavior carries over to the entire population.
